CANADIAN PAIN SOCIETY MEMBERSHIP<br />
REGULAR MEMBER: $195.00, plus HST<br />
Health care professionals, scientists and any other persons interested in the objectives of the <strong>Society</strong> are eligible for<br />
Regular Membership status of the <strong>Canadian</strong> <strong>Pain</strong> <strong>Society</strong> (CPS). Each Regular Member of the <strong>Society</strong> shall be entitled<br />
to one vote on matters brought before the Membership.<br />
TRAINEE MEMBER: $45.00, plus HST<br />
Proof of status must accompany application. Students, residents or interns at the pre-doctoral, doctoral or pre-professional<br />
level of their careers will be classified as Trainee Members.<br />
